Album Notes

Drawing from the finest wellsprings of popular music, incorporating jazz, soul, funk, & blues, The Spike Band brings a style of music that blurs the lines of musical genres. The five piece band, made up of vocals, keyboards, guitar, bass, drums and trumpet performs original music, written by leader Spike Sikes. The group has been likened to such artists as Stevie Wonder, Jamiroquai, Norah Jones, Maroon 5, Sting, Ray Charles and Jaime Cullum.

“What It Is” is the groups second album, and contains nine new original tracks. While this record has a very unified and connected sound overall, each track brings a different style and flavor to the album. The funk/pop sound of "Thursday", the Reggae feel of "Red", and the acoustic pop/jazz feel of "On the Road to Memphis" are just three of the examples of how the music differs from track to track while maintaining a sense of unity and flow. This album's appeal reaches across age lines, much like the albums of the artists that inspire this group.
